Press Alt+M and the page you're reading becomes clean, correct Markdown on your clipboard — ready to paste into any LLM or Note taker. Downright is a markdown clipper built around one idea: the Markdown must be RIGHT. WHAT COMES OUT CORRECT • Tables — real Markdown pipe tables, including merged cells (colspan/rowspan), alignment, and pipes inside cells. The thing most converters silently mangle. • Code — fenced blocks that keep their language (Prism, Shiki, highlight.js, GitHub markup all recognized), with line-number gutters stripped. • Math — KaTeX and MathJax equations come back as their original LaTeX, not garbled symbols. Wikipedia formulas extract perfectly. • Links & images — every URL resolved to an absolute address, including lazy-loaded images. Clips work outside the page they came from. • Modern sites — Downright reads the rendered page, so single-page apps, logged-in pages, and web components (Shadow DOM) all clip correctly. THREE WAYS TO CLIP • Alt+M (Option+M on Mac) — copy the article as Markdown. Select text first and the same keystroke clips just the selection, keeping list numbering and table headers. • Right-click — copy the selection or page, or save the page as a .md file. • Toolbar popup — preview the Markdown before you copy, switch between Article and Full-page capture, and see a token estimate for AI context windows. You always find out what happened: every clip raises a toast with the token count, or the reason it couldn't run. Pages extensions aren't allowed to touch — browser settings, the extension gallery, the PDF viewer, local files without file access — say so by name instead of failing silently. Optional YAML front matter (title, source URL, author, date) makes clips land in major note taking apps perfectly. PRIVATE BY CONSTRUCTION • No network requests, ever — verified by an automated audit on every release. • No host permissions — Downright cannot read any page until the moment you invoke it, and never in the background. • No accounts, no analytics, no tracking. Free, and open source on GitHub so you can check all of the above. • Text a page hides from you — off-screen, zero-opacity, or written in invisible Unicode — is dropped, not clipped. What you can read is what you get. Source code: https://github.com/jayasankarmr/Downright
